WebMar 31, 2024 · There are many strategies for trading stocks. One of the best strategies is to not trade them at all. Instead, you buy and hold. You buy shares of stock, then hold them for years and years. The complete opposite strategy would be day trading, which is when you buy shares and then sell them the same day before the market closes. WebDec 1, 2024 · Typically, you'll either pay short-term or long-term capital gains tax rates depending on your holding period for the investment. Short-term rates are the same as for ordinary income such as the tax on wages. For 2024, these rates range from 10% to 37% depending on taxable income.
